With a 30% surge in application volume over last year's pool of 51,500, Cornell received roughly 67,000 applications this past cycle and admitted 5,836that makes for an 8.7% acceptance rate, down from 10.7% last year. A Major with Options Students wishing to major in Fashion Design & Management must pick between two options: Fashion Design (Option I) and Fashion Design Management (Option II). For the Class of 2025, Cornell admitted 1,930 out of 9,017 early decision applicants (about a 27 percent increase over the past year's ED applicant numbers), for a 21.4 percent acceptance rate (a 1.2 percent decrease from the Class of 2024). . The 8.7% acceptance rate for Cornell's Class of 2025 was the lowest in school history; as late as 2003, the school still had as high as a 31% acceptance rate.
